Transaction 76dfa7a671d5aa281ab7700047345752cfd0f730779be2cf3c0eba4d566f012f

50 Input
1 Outputs
  • 76dfa7a671d5aa281ab7700047345752cfd0f730779be2cf3c0eba4d566f012f:0
  • value  123822719
    address  19ve3JWXnvMCeFaKoWpXQ8mHJxT5DHyHU2